Temporal and spatial trends of marine tourism in the Canadian Arctic: Risks and opportunities

A changing climate and reductions in sea ice has made the Canadian Arctic more accessible to maritime traffic. Ship traffic in the Canadian Arctic has tripled over the past decade. Increased marine traffic = opportunities & risks
